To approximate the square root of 38, we can identify the two whole numbers between which \(\sqrt{38}\) lies.
We know that:
- \(6^2 = 36\)
- \(7^2 = 49\)
Since \(36 < 38 < 49\), it follows that:
\[
6 < \sqrt{38} < 7
\]
Thus, the approximate square root of 38 lies between the whole numbers **6 and 7**.
